قُلۡ يَـٰٓأَيُّهَا ٱلنَّاسُ إِنَّمَآ أَنَا۠ لَكُمۡ نَذِيرٞ مُّبِينٞ
Say: ‘People! I am only a clear warner for you.’
فَٱلَّذِينَ ءَامَنُواْ وَعَمِلُواْ ٱلصَّـٰلِحَٰتِ لَهُم مَّغۡفِرَةٞ وَرِزۡقٞ كَرِيمٞ
Those who believe and do righteous deeds – for them (there is) forgiveness and generous provision.
وَٱلَّذِينَ سَعَوۡاْ فِيٓ ءَايَٰتِنَا مُعَٰجِزِينَ أُوْلَـٰٓئِكَ أَصۡحَٰبُ ٱلۡجَحِيمِ
But those who strive against Our signs to obstruct (them) – those are the companions of the Furnace.
Allah said to His Prophet, when the disbelievers asked him to hasten on the punishment for them:
meaning, 'Allah has sent me to you to warn you ahead of the terrible punishment, but I have nothing to do with your reckoning. Your case rests with Allah: if He wills, He will hasten on the punishment for you; and if He wills, He will delay it for you. If He wills he will accept the repentance of those who repent to Him; and if He wills, He will send astray those who are decreed to be doomed. He is the One Who does whatsoever He wills and wants and chooses.
{There is none to put back His judgement and He is swift at reckoning.} [13:41]
means, whose hearts believe and whose actions confirm their faith.
means, forgiveness for their previous bad deeds, and a great reward in return for a few good deeds. Muhammad bin Ka'b Al-Qurazi said, "When you hear Allah's saying:
{Rizq Karim} this means Paradise."
Mujahid said, "To discourage people from following the Prophet." This was also the view of 'Abdullah bin Az-Zubayr, "to discourage." Ibn 'Abbas said, "To frustrate them means to resist the believers stubbornly."
This refers to the agonizingly hot Fire with its severe punishment, may Allah save us from it. Allah says:
{Those who disbelieved and hinder (men) from the path of Allah, for them We will add torment to the torment because they used to spread corruption} [16:88]
— from Tafsir Ibn Kathir (Vol. 6, Page 594-596)
